Output f31563b48c4b5c8c55cee003bbdea64fcffa33e08c980b832e8a9324ca304e49:20

value
139911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89494a6b402b97905fd1fbe9b807a4f16cb8b468 OP_EQUAL
address
3ECvJ9k7VNe5FwkUGarBgYFqZAUcZ8yweA
transaction
f31563b48c4b5c8c55cee003bbdea64fcffa33e08c980b832e8a9324ca304e49